A contractor’s bond protects consumers up to the bond amount if the contractor fails to fulfill contractual obligations or violates CSLB regulations.

Workers’ compensation insurance protects homeowners from liability if a contractor’s employee is injured on the job site.

About These License Types

ASB: Asbestos Certification

An add-on certification that allows a contractor to perform asbestos abatement work within the scope of their existing license classification(s). This is not a standalone license.

Not authorized: Can only perform abatement within existing classification scope.

B: General Building Contractor

Authorizes construction of structures including residential, commercial, and industrial buildings requiring at least two unrelated building trades or crafts. May take prime contracts or subcontracts for framing or carpentry. May subcontract all specialty work but must hold the appropriate C license to self-perform specialty trade work.

Not authorized: Cannot self-perform specialty trade work (electrical, plumbing, HVAC, etc.) without holding the corresponding C license. Cannot contract for C-16 Fire Protection or C-57 Well Drilling without the appropriate license or subcontractor.

C-20: Warm-Air Heating, Ventilating and Air-Conditioning (HVAC) Contractor

Fabricates, installs, maintains, services, and repairs warm-air heating systems and water heating heat pumps, ventilating systems, air-conditioning systems, and the ducts, registers, flues, humidity and thermostatic controls and air filters in connection with these systems. Includes solar-powered HVAC systems.

Not authorized: Does not include boiler or steam heating (see C-4) or refrigeration below 50F (see C-38).

C-21: Building Moving/Demolition Contractor

Raises, lowers, cribs, underpins, demolishes, moves, or removes structures including their foundations.

Not authorized: Does not include alterations, additions, repairs, or rehabilitation of permanently retained portions of structures.

C-27: Landscaping Contractor

Constructs, maintains, repairs, and installs landscape systems and facilities for public and private gardens, including preparing and grading plots for architectural, horticultural, and decorative treatments.

C-38: Refrigeration Contractor

Constructs, fabricates, erects, installs, maintains, services, and repairs refrigerators, refrigerated rooms, insulated spaces, temperature insulation, air-conditioning units, ducts, blowers, and thermostatic controls for temperatures below 50 degrees Fahrenheit (10 degrees Celsius).

Not authorized: Temperatures above 50F fall under C-20 HVAC.

D28: Doors, Gates and Activating Devices

Installs, maintains, and repairs doors, gates, and their activating devices including automatic openers.

D49: Tree Service

Provides tree trimming, removal, and maintenance services.

D59: Hydroseed Spraying

Performs hydroseeding and hydromulching services.

D63: Construction Clean-Up

Provides construction site clean-up services.

D64: Non-Specialized

A general limited specialty designation for work not covered by any other D subcategory.
